The Port Authority successfully concluded a comprehensive two-day Level One training program for newly appointed security officers from the Grand Turk and Providenciales branches. The curriculum covered essential security protocols, including access control, pedestrian and baggage searches, vehicle searches, bomb threat response, incident reporting and writing,security patrolling, threats to maritime security and, Security levels.
Following the instruction, an examination was administered to assess the officers' comprehension of the material. The session was facilitated by Training and Compliance Manager Mrs. Sharonna Walkin-Brown, assisted by Security Supervisor James Rigby and Security Officers Mr. Andy Delancy and Mr. Elliott Johnson. Notably, Pors Authority Intern Miss Stubbs also participated in the training and successfully passed the examination with a 90% average.
